1. What Is The Distance To Ruidoso, New Mexico, From Major Cities?

The distance to Ruidoso, New Mexico, varies depending on your starting point. Here’s a breakdown from several major cities:

  • El Paso, Texas: Approximately 130 miles (209 km).
  • Albuquerque, New Mexico: Roughly 185 miles (298 km).
  • Las Cruces, New Mexico: Around 150 miles (241 km).
  • Midland, Texas: Approximately 260 miles (418 km).
  • Dallas, Texas: About 530 miles (853 km).

Ruidoso is nestled in the Sierra Blanca mountain range of southern New Mexico, offering a unique blend of natural beauty and small-town charm.

2. How Do I Get To Ruidoso, New Mexico?

You can reach Ruidoso, New Mexico, by car or plane. Here are the details:

  • By Car: Ruidoso is accessible via several highways. From El Paso, you can take US-54 North to US-70 East. From Albuquerque, you can take US-380 East.
  • By Plane: The closest major airports are:
    • El Paso International Airport (ELP): About 130 miles away.
    • Albuquerque International Sunport (ABQ): Approximately 185 miles away.
    • Sierra Blanca Regional Airport (SRR): Located about 18 miles northeast of Ruidoso, primarily for private aircraft.

Once you arrive at these airports, you can rent a car or take a shuttle to Ruidoso.

22. What Is The Altitude Of Ruidoso, New Mexico?

The altitude of Ruidoso, New Mexico, is approximately 6,920 feet (2,110 meters) above sea level.

Visitors may experience altitude sickness, especially upon arrival. Drink plenty of water, avoid strenuous activities, and allow your body time to adjust.

25. What Day Trips Can I Take From Ruidoso?

Ruidoso is a great base for day trips:

  • Lincoln, New Mexico: Visit the historic town where Billy the Kid made his mark.
  • White Sands National Park: Explore the stunning white gypsum sand dunes.
  • Cloudcroft, New Mexico: A charming mountain village with unique shops and restaurants.
  • Roswell, New Mexico: Visit the International UFO Museum and Research Center.

These day trips offer a chance to explore the diverse attractions of southern New Mexico.

34. What Should I Know About Altitude Sickness In Ruidoso?

Altitude sickness can affect visitors to Ruidoso due to its high elevation:

  • Symptoms: Headache, nausea, fatigue, dizziness.
  • Prevention: Drink plenty of water, avoid alcohol and caffeine, eat light meals, avoid strenuous activity, and ascend gradually.
  • Treatment: Rest, descend to a lower altitude, and take medication if necessary.

Be prepared for the effects of altitude and take steps to prevent and treat altitude sickness.
